The
joystick or switches (4-switch users only), that are used to drive the
chair, will also act as a remote mouse pointer - move your joystick
and the mouse pointer moves with it!
You
can have it proportional too - the further you move the joystick - or
the longer you hold the switch down (for switch users) - the faster the
mouse pointer moves on the screen. Alternativly, mouse movement can be
set to a less sensitive rate moving slowly across the screen. A seperate
switch can be used for the mouse click.
The
wiseDX does not have a scanning mouse facility.Users not operating
a joystick or 4 switches should use an existing on screen mouse emulator.
To
use this feature you will need the 'GEWA mouse/keyboard interface' which
receives infrared signals from the wiseDX.
